Sample Daily Rhythm *

  • 8:30 - 9:00 am rolling drop off

  • Free play I (child lead)

  • Welcome Circle (teacher lead)

  • Snack

  • Free play II (child lead)

  • Special activity (teacher lead)**

  • 12:10 - 12:30 Lunch

  • Settle in for rest time/rest/quiet time

  • Large group games (teacher or student lead)

  • Closing Circle (teacher lead)

  • Clean up, walk to pick up area

  • 2:45 - 3:00 Dismissal and pick up

​

*Except for drop-off, lunch, and pick-up, the rhythm is fluid, and times are not set in stone (no pun intended). Teachers will adjust the starting and ending times of activities depending on the children's interest and engagement.

​

**Examples of a special activity might include science experiments, painting, special tool use, art, language, music, yoga, etc. Special activities may differ each day or continue throughout the week as needed or as deemed necessary by Nurtured by Nature Staff.

DROP-OFF AND PICK-UP

Drop off and pick up will be at a designated spot in each natural area. Parents will be notified if drop off/pick up has been changed to the indoor location. Drop off is a rolling drop-off from 8:30 am – 9:00 am. Please do your very best to arrive during this window. As a forest school, we may be hiking further into the woods and will be leaving the designated drop-off area precisely at 9 am.

 

The pick-up window is from 2:45 - 3:00 pm.  

 

If your child is arriving late or leaving early, we ask that you come during lunchtime from 12:10 to 12:45. Due to our nomadic immersion into natural areas, it is difficult to accommodate late arrivals or departures, and this significantly impacts our routine and rhythm.
